Dhaka’s air quality unhealthy

City Desk :
Dhaka has ranked 10th on the list of cities worldwide with the worst air quality with an AQI score of 128 at 9:10am on Sunday.

Dhaka’s air was classified as “unhealthy”, according to the air quality index, reports UNB.

India’s Delhi, Thailand’s Chiang Mai and Pakistan’s Lahore occupied the first, second and third spots on the list, with AQI scores of 339, 226 and 194 respectively.

When the AQI value for particle pollution is between 50 and 100, air quality is considered moderate; between 101 and 150, air quality is considered unhealthy for sensitive groups; between 150 and 200 is unhealthy; between 201 and 300 is said to be very unhealthy; while a reading of 301+ is considered hazardous, posing serious health risks to residents.

The AQI, an index for reporting daily air quality, informs people how clean or polluted the air of a certain city is and what associated health effects might be a concern for them.
